Enhance Retail Profitability via Integrated ERP Systems
Retail businesses are constantly seeking innovative ways to increase profitability. One effective strategy is to implement integrated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) systems. These comprehensive software solutions streamline key business processes, leading in significant financial savings and enhanced operational efficiency.
An integrated ERP system unifies various departments within a retail organization, such as finance, inventory management, sales, and customer service. This seamless interaction allows for real-time data sharing and informed decision-making. By minimizing manual tasks and redundancies, ERP systems free up valuable time and resources that can be allocated to expansion initiatives.
Furthermore, integrated ERP systems provide retailers with powerful insights into customer behavior, market trends, and product performance. This detailed understanding enables businesses to customize their offerings, reach specific customer segments effectively, and enhance marketing campaigns.
